]> git.ipfire.org Git - thirdparty/ldns.git/commitdiff
added --libdir handling
authorJelte Jansen <jeltejan@NLnetLabs.nl>
Wed, 5 Oct 2005 09:15:26 +0000 (09:15 +0000)
committerJelte Jansen <jeltejan@NLnetLabs.nl>
Wed, 5 Oct 2005 09:15:26 +0000 (09:15 +0000)
Makefile.in

index cdd7e7bfdd23ccaeba230f7acc4a050a59272ff1..6e26be702c5d1fe395b9c2534fdf9ce3a4602462 100644 (file)
@@ -8,6 +8,7 @@ prefix          = @prefix@
 exec_prefix    = @exec_prefix@
 bindir                 = @bindir@
 mandir                 = @mandir@
+libdir         = @libdir@
 doxygen                = @doxygen@
 glibtool       = @glibtool@
 libtool                = @libtool@
@@ -162,7 +163,7 @@ uninstall-progs:
                for i in $(PROG_TARGETS); do \
                        rm -f $(bindir)/$$i ; done
                exit 0
-               rmdir --ignore-fail-on-non-empty $(bindir)
+               rmdir -p --ignore-fail-on-non-empty $(bindir)
 
 install-doc:   doc
                ${INSTALL} -d $(mandir)/man3
@@ -178,9 +179,7 @@ uninstall-doc:      doc
                for i in $(PROG_TARGETS); do \
                        rm -f $(mandir)/man1/$$i.1 ; done
                exit 0
-               rmdir --ignore-fail-on-non-empty $(mandir)/man3
-               rmdir --ignore-fail-on-non-empty $(mandir)/man1
-               rmdir --ignore-fail-on-non-empty $(mandir)
+               rmdir -p --ignore-fail-on-non-empty $(mandir)/man3
 
 install-h:     lib
                $(INSTALL) -m 755 -d $(prefix)/include/ldns
@@ -190,17 +189,17 @@ install-h:        lib
 uninstall-h:
                for i in $(LIBDNS_HEADERS); do \
                        rm -f $(prefix)/include/$$i; done
-               [ ! -d $(prefix)/include/ldns ] || rmdir --ignore-fail-on-non-empty $(prefix)/include/ldns ; rmdir --ignore-fail-on-non-empty $(prefix)/include
+               [ ! -d $(prefix)/include/ldns ] || rmdir -p --ignore-fail-on-non-empty $(prefix)/include/ldns
                exit 0
        
 install-lib:   lib
-               $(INSTALL) -m 755 -d $(prefix)/lib
-               $(LIBTOOL) --mode=install cp libldns.la $(prefix)/lib
-               $(LIBTOOL) --mode=finish $(prefix)/lib
+               $(INSTALL) -m 755 -d $(libdir)
+               $(LIBTOOL) --mode=install cp libldns.la $(libdir)
+               $(LIBTOOL) --mode=finish $(libdir)
 
 uninstall-lib: 
-               $(LIBTOOL) --mode=uninstall rm -f $(prefix)/lib/libldns.la
-               rmdir --ignore-fail-on-non-empty $(prefix)/lib
+               $(LIBTOOL) --mode=uninstall rm -f $(libdir)/libldns.la
+               rmdir -p --ignore-fail-on-non-empty $(libdir)
 
 snapshot:      distclean
                (rm -rf ../ldns-snap-$(DATE)/)
@@ -242,7 +241,6 @@ realclean: clean docclean libclean
        rm -f config.sub
        rm -f config.guess
        rm -f ltmain.sh
-       (cd drill ; $(MAKE) -f Makefile realclean)
 
 docclean:
        rm -rf doc/html/